David is an
established author
and semi-retired
professional engineer
who has held three Quality Director roles and now runs his own business helping other businesses to improve their quality systems. His diagnosis of prostate cancer (at Gleason 9) shocked the whole family and changed his life. Intrusive treatments followed over an 18-month period. Now, he currently has a PSA blood reading that is undetectable after several months of zero readings. He still doesn't really understand how this has happened but this book details his journey - it is emotional and heart-tugging but also contains valuable lessons learned along the way. It was never an option not to get through this and never an option to give in. He wants to share this with you and if this helps then it has done the job it was intended to do.
"I want to project hope and inspiration. Awareness of this killer is fundamental to recovery - please go and get tested because early diagnosis can save
lives."

Barnes & Noble does business -- big business -- by the book. As the #1 bookseller in the US, it operates about 720 Barnes & Noble superstores (selling books, music, movies, and gifts) throughout all 50 US states and Washington, DC. The stores are typically 10,000 to 60,000 sq. ft. and stock between 60,000 and 200,000 book titles. Many of its locations contain Starbucks cafes, as well as music departments that carry more than 30,000 titles.
